Equine Nutrition Management

Equine nutrition management refers to the practice of providing horses with the appropriate diet and nutrients they need for optimal health, performance, and well-being.

Key Features

  • Balanced diet planning
  • Digestive system health
  • Weight management
  • Nutrient absorption and utilization
  • Feed quality assessment

Pros

  • Ensures horses receive proper nutrition for their specific needs
  • Helps prevent health issues related to poor diet
  • Enhances overall performance and well-being of the horse

Cons

  • Can be time-consuming and require specialized knowledge
  • Costly to maintain a high-quality diet for horses
